Job Description

East Suffolk Council is an exciting place to work, delivering essential local services and making a real difference to a quarter of a million people across East Suffolk.

We currently have an opportunity to join East Suffolk Council's finance team as a Specialist Accountant – Project and Fixed Assets.

The role:

This is a newly created role within the finance team, with responsibility for the Authority’s Fixed Asset Register ensuring full technical compliance, including all relevant entries and sections for the Statement of Accounts.

  • You will lead and represent the Council on key fixed asset accounting workstreams ensuring full technical compliance, both internal and working collaboratively alongside other partnerships and organisations.
  • You will be responsible for the implementation of changes impacting the Council’s Asset Register ensuring it is complete and correct.
  • Contribution to the progression of various corporate initiatives in accordance to ensure the Council is compliant with all relevant policies, financial legislation, and statutory requirements.
  • Working in collaboration with colleagues, you will ensure that the whole service is delivered in a professional manner in accordance with relevant statutory requirements and policies.

What you will need:

  • Ideally you will be CCAB qualified, although significant experience in a similar role with a desire to achieve qualifications will be considered.
  • Advanced technical knowledge and experience relating to Local Authority fixed asset accounting and experience in improving control and processes surrounding this.
  • Experience of successful operation delivery within a changing environment would be advantageous along with the ability to understand complex financial reporting issues.
  • Communication skills are key as you will be dealing with colleagues across East Suffolk Council at all levels, so self-awareness and political awareness in decision making is also key.

Why work for us?

East Suffolk Council is a great place to work and there are lots of benefits our employees can access. To find out more about why we are so proud of East Suffolk Council, take a look at our video and hear why our employees think it is such a great place to work (YouTube).

Here are some of the main benefits:

  • Generous leave entitlement (equivalent to 25 days a year, increasing to 31 days after 5 years’ service, plus bank holidays)
  • Local government pension scheme
  • Flexible working arrangements
  • Learning and development tailored to your role
  • A wide variety of staff support networks including access to health and wellbeing initiatives and programmes.
  • Discounts on mobile phones, computers, holiday and travel, fashion and clothing, health and beauty and many other products and services.

Find more information about what we offer in our benefits brochure (pdf).

The majority of our teams are working in an agile way, with a mixture of home and office working, depending on individual preferences and service requirements.
